`@majorheading', `@chapheading'
===============================
The `@majorheading' and `@chapheading' commands put chapter-like
headings in the body of a document.
However, neither command causes TeX to produce a numbered heading or
an entry in the table of contents; and neither command causes TeX to
start a new page in a printed manual.
In TeX, an `@majorheading' command generates a larger vertical
whitespace before the heading than an `@chapheading' command but is
otherwise the same.
In Info, the `@majorheading' and `@chapheading' commands are
equivalent to `@chapter': the title is printed on a line by itself with
a line of asterisks underneath. (Note:`@chapter'.)
